A simple 2 part packaging to allow one of our Wireless Inertial Measurement Units to be used as a 6 sided die.
Version: 0.4 Date: 2012-02-23
To do: add option to add mouse-ears to prevent curling during printing fix bottom positioning bugs in rounded cuboid 2.6 module when switching from cylinder-sphere type
Warning: Printing the rounded edges on the bottom face is not easy with a makerbot type machine, support structures can be added but this will require removal with a sharp knife/dremel etc. be careful! None
Changes from previous versions: 0.4
- used cross shaped module and difference to make printed object use less material 0.3
- added pips to each face and supports to hold electronics safely within dice 0.2
- a simple side by side 2 part hollow rounded cube with interlocking lips to hold them together 0.1
- first attempt, just a simple cube+sphere minkowski operation Warning: There are definitely a few bugs in the rounded cuboid 2.6 file. Also it will take a long time to generate the first time (up to 10 minutes on an old Pentium 4 machine) as minkowski sums with spheres are very cumbersome
Also I have attached a screenshot of a Labview GUI that calculates which side of the dice is facing up.
Instruções
- Open .SCAD file and adjust parameters to fit your electronic dice components (in our case a ~303238mm WIMU)
- Print and clean any rough edges
- Make the pips different colours using paint etc.
- Write simple code to convert motion data into dice values
- Turn on and insert your electronic dice
- Roll!
- Get dice top face value
